HC Deb 25 June 1951 vol 489 c99W
Mr. P. Thorneycroft

asked the Secretary of State for Foreign Affairs whether he has yet received any information upon the mass internment of Hungarian families by the Hungarian Government; and whether he proposes to take any action in the matter, in view of the Human Rights Clause in the Peace Treaty.

Mr. Younger

I have nothing to add to the reply given on 20th June to a similar Question.
